Tata IPL 2022 – GT vs LSG match preview, predicted lineups

GT vs LSG
Match no. 4 of IPL 2022 between GT and LSG takes place today

Gujarat Titans will take on Lucknow Super Giants in 2022 Tata IPL opener for both teams as they mark their arrival on the scene. They will be desperate for a win.

Date & Time : 28th March 2022, 7:30 PM IST

Venue : Wankhede Stadium, Mumbai

Gujarat Titans as they seem like aren’t that new also to the IPL scene having been previously played as Gujarat Lions in IPL but still they are a new franchise and they return after some years. The moral of the story is that Gujarat fans have had a team in the past.

They are captained by Hardik Pandya and coached by Ashish Nehra. So they have the required set up. All they have to do is play to potential and express themselves.

GT are a team with good bowling options having the likes of maestro Rashid Khan in their team. The wicket-keeping options too are in aplenty as Aussie Matthew Wade and Indian test keeper Wriddhiman Saha are their behind the stumps. Batting wise they have Shubman Gill amongst their ranks.

As for the Lucknow Super Giants, it will be a first occasion in the illustrated history of IPL that a UP based team will play the tournament. So a proud moment for the Uttar Pradesh public.

Coming to the team LSG will be captained by experienced KL Rahul and coached by Zimbabwean Andy Flower. With that being the man behind the franchise one can expect professionalism.

LSG are a good solid side with a mixture of good overseas and Indian players. They have guys like Holder, Quinton de Kock along with Krunal Pandya. They will be looking forward to the competition.

This is nothing surprising that this is the first meeting between the two sides in the history of the IPL.

The Wankhede deck is a good one for the batters with some assistance for spinners.

Team news and possible lineups

Their are no fresh injury concerns for both the sides at the moment.

GT XI : Gill, Wade (WK), A. Manohar, H. Pandya (C), V. Shankar, Miller, Tewatia, R. Khan, Shami, L. Ferguson, P. Sangwan.

LSG XI : Rahul (C), De Kock (WK), E. Lewis, M. Vohra, M. Pandey, K. Pandya, Hooda, Bishnoi, A. Khan, A. Rajpoot, Chameera.
